Position Summary

Fusion is currently seeking a talented and highly motivated R&D Engineer with a PE to join our team supporting a Counter‑Weapons of Mass Destruction (CWMD) program for the Intelligence Community (IC) and Department of Defense (DoD). This position will work as part of a team responsible for reverse engineering facilities and developing new methodologies, tools and products to support deliberate planning and crisis operations for the full-dimensional defeat of aboveground and belowground WMD‑related hard targets.

Security Clearance Requirement
  • Active DoD Top Secret/SCI clearance with final CI Poly is required
  • Must be a US citizenship and able to pass extensive background checks.
Required Skills and Qualifications
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ience designing, managing, and/or maintaining installation and facility infrastructure within the chemical, energy, oil, biotechnical, pharmaceutical, or defense industries
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to produce technical reports and presentations and deliver briefings to both technical and non-technical personnel
Key Responsibilities
  • Provide technical assessments of systems for industrial facilities and hardened structures, including infrastructure and equipment layouts
  • Perform engineering calculations
  • Conduct vulnerability analysis and identify critical nodes
  • Conduct system analysis to understand upstream and downstream effects on industrial processes and other utility systems
  • Collaborate with modeling and simulation SMEs to develop models that determine how to disrupt and/or defeat the functions of various mechanical systems or equipment
  • Develop reconstitution estimates for mechanical infrastructure or equipment that has been damaged or destroyed
  • Support test operations to validate developed methodologies and tools
  • Travel: Up to 5% travel required
Education and Experience
  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ering or a related technical field. At least five (5) years of directly related operational experience may be accepted in lieu of a degree
  • Current Professional Engineer (PE) license required
  • Working knowledge of utility systems, including industrial water, wastewater, power, inert gas, compressed/instrument air, hydraulic, industrial controls, and/or fuel systems
Desired Qualifications

Experience in one or more of the following areas is preferred but not required:

  • Engineering or utility operations for an installation, facility or vessel (i.e. ship’s engine room)
  • Nuclear, chemical, petrochemical or manufacturing facilities
  • Industrial plant and processing operations, including process startup, operations, and safety
